Analysis

The most recent figure for gross enrolment ratio, primary to tertiary, gender parity index in Senegal is 1.11 GPI, measured in 2019. That is the highest value across all 17 years on record.

That represents a change of up 19.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, gross enrolment ratio, primary to tertiary, gender parity index in Senegal peaked at 1.11 GPI in 2019 and was at its lowest, 0.5865 GPI, in 1971.

Senegal ranks 29th of 173 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 17 years of available data.

Gross enrolment ratio, primary to tertiary, gender parity index in Senegal, year by year

Annual values for Gross enrolment ratio, primary to tertiary, gender parity index (GPI) in Senegal, 1971 to 2019.
Year GPI Change
1971 0.5865 GPI
1972 0.5938 GPI +1.2%
1978 0.6127 GPI +3.2%
1980 0.6189 GPI +1.0%
1981 0.6181 GPI -0.1%
1982 0.6216 GPI +0.6%
1984 0.6285 GPI +1.1%
1985 0.635 GPI +1.0%
1992 0.6836 GPI +7.7%
2006 0.9007 GPI +31.8%
2008 0.9288 GPI +3.1%
2010 0.9717 GPI +4.6%
2011 1.02 GPI +4.6%
2012 1.02 GPI +0.0%
2013 1.03 GPI +0.9%
2014 1.04 GPI +1.0%
2019 1.11 GPI +6.7%

Ratio of female gross enrolment ratio for primary to tertiary to the male value for the same indicator. It is calculated by dividing the female value for the indicator by the male value for the indicator. A GPI equal to 1 indicates parity between females and males. In general, a value less than 1 indicates disparity in favor of males and a value greater than 1 indicates disparity in favor of females.
